FanDuel DFS Point Guards

Isaiah Thomas (vs SAC, $7,800)

Look at it this way. The field is going to invest heavily in Thomas. I imagine somewhere in the 65-75% range. That’s just how good this matchup is. So even if you roster Thomas and he lays a dud- something that is not likely to happen- then it still won’t hurt as much as say, giving a roster spot to Rajon Rondo against the number one point guard defense.

Emmanuel Mudiay (at NY, $5,400)

Despite continuing to turn the ball over like, well, a rookie point guard, Mudiay has put up some strong performances as of late. His minutes have been reaching into the low to mid-30s, and he has shown he is quite capable of draining buckets and dishing out dimes. Hopefully the Nuggets keep the rookie on the court because, he should make Jose Calderon look like the New Orleans Saints secondary. If you don’t watch football, that means he is going to get burned on the reg.

 

FanDuel DFS Shooting Guards

Victor Oladipo (vs ATL, $6,500)

Oladipo was on a fantastic run in two straight games last week before it all came crashing down against the Clippers. The shooting/point guard dropped a total of 94.5 FanDuel points in two straight games before drawing a lot of defense from Chris Paul on Friday night. Still, the guy saw 36 minutes of playing time, indicating that Orlando is intent on playing despite the Magic headed towards the Toilet Bowl. Look for a nice bounce back against the Hawks.

Avery Bradley (vs SAC, $5,500)

This Sacramento-Boston game looks juicy. It features two teams that play really fast, should have the highest projected point total of the game, and Marco Belinelli on defense! He owns a 112 DRating and if you attempt to quantify that on a scientific scale, that means that he couldn’t even guard Peyton Manning off the dribble. Go get ‘em, Avery.

 

FanDuel DFS Small Forwards

Kent Bazemore (at ORL, $5,100)

Do you trust Bazemore? Me neither. But he makes a lot of sense on Superbowl Sunday. There are question marks abound at the swing position and though Bazemore is not without his, he does make sense against Orlando. The Magic have given up over 43 FanDuel points per game over their last five to opposing small forwards, third-most in The Association. Bazemore is coming off a nice game in which he recorded 15 points, one board, eight dimes and three steals, and he is typically a guy that likes to play in spurts.

Omri Casspi (at BOS, $5,100)

A Casspi roster makes sense only if there is confirmation that Rudy Gay will sit again. It also makes a lot of sense if Ben McLemore sits as well. That’s a lot of minutes, shots, rebounds and usage rate that needs to be picked up.

 

FanDuel DFS Power Forwards

Paul Millsap (at ORL, $7,800)

Another guy that figures to be heavily owned mainly because there are really not a whole lot of great options, Millsap has been rather erratic since the start of the second half of the NBA season. He is still scoring his fair share for the Hawks, but what’s up with the rebounds, bro? Millsap is averaging over 8.5 rebounds per game on the year, but has only grabbed double-digit boards twice in his last seven games. Still, Orlando’s is a frontcourt you can pick on, so he is still a cash safe play.

Kristaps Porzingis (vs DEN, $6,400)

After dudding up for most of the last two weeks, Porzin-God came back with authority with a nice 17 point, 10 rebound performance against the Grizzlies. Word out of New York is that Melo will most likely play, which may jerk Porzingis’ ownership numbers around. It’s a no-brainer that Porzingis should get the start if Melo does not dress, but you can make the case that he is still a great play against Kenneth Faried if Anthony does play.

 

FanDuel DFS Centers

DeMarcus Cousins (at BOS, $11,100)

Did you expect anyone else? Look, you didn’t really pay up at other spots so why not spend your fake cheese on the big hoss. Who is going to slow him down?
